Consider 2 kg of butane at pressure of 7.6 MPa in a rigid tank of 0.008 m3 volume.

(a) Calculate the temperature (K) of butane.

(b) Can butane be either cooled or heated to its critical state from its given condition in the rigid tank? Explain.
